A lot of sellers mainly overseas based in asia will list items cheaper but charge extremely high postage rates and not allow buyers to combine purchases. Ebay takes a final value fee percentage of the actual sale price so if an item only sells for 99 cents ebay will only make a small amount from that sale. However ebay wont make a cut from the amount being charged on the postage costs so these sellers make there ebay fee free profits from the over charged postage rates rather than the final sale fees. Of course if the buyer pays via paypal the seller still gets charge for the full sale amount but they are saving a huge amount on ebay fees by selling cheap and charging high on postage.
